Inventory- keeping accurate documentation of the food and drinks used at the facility and ordering when
necessary
Budgeting- working with a specified amount of money without going over the limit.
Accomplishments Culinary Degree-indicates at least a basic knowledge of culinary skills
ServSafe Certification- indicates an understanding of foodborne illnesses and how to prevent them.
A.C.F. certified- also indicates a basic knowledge of culinary skills.
Knowledge Production-Preparing the food dishes in a timely manner and being prepared to create those dishes at a
specific time.
Customer service-Always being friendly to the customers no matter what the situation and fixing any
problems they might have with as little fuss as possible.
Recruiting-Understanding the hiring process and being a good judge of character
Skills Organized- eliminating all clutter from your specified work area and keeping it that way throughout
production.
Knife skills- being able to perform basic knife cuts (Dice, Cube, Julienne, etc.).
Communication-being able to clearly state exactly what you need done and understanding others when
they are telling you what to do.
